TP钱包合约交互失败会不会退回
TP钱包是一款支持以太坊网络的移动钱包应用程序,它允许用户进行数字货币的存储、发送和接收,并且可以与智能合约进行交互。在使用TP钱包进行合约交互时,一个常见的疑问是,如果合约交互失败,是否会退回交易。
合约交互失败的情况
在TP钱包进行合约交互时,有以下几种可能导致交互失败的情况:
- 合约地址错误:如果输入的合约地址不正确,钱包无法找到对应的合约,交互将失败。
- 合约方法调用失败:在调用智能合约的方法时,可能因为参数错误、权限不足或其他原因导致方法调用失败。
- 合约执行失败:合约方法调用成功,但是在执行合约代码时发生异常或错误,导致交互失败。
TP钱包合约交互失败的处理
当合约交互失败时,TP钱包的处理方式是不会自动退回交易的。在区块链上,一旦交易被广播并写入区块,就无法撤销或修改。因此,如果合约交互失败,交易将继续保留在区块链中,并且相应的费用也会被消耗。
对于TP钱包用户来说,可以通过以下方式来处理合约交互失败的情况:
- 确认交易失败:在TP钱包中查看交易的状态,确认交易是否失败。
- 重新发送交易:如果交易失败,用户可以尝试重新发送交易,确保输入正确的合约地址和参数。
- 联系技术支持:如果交易一直失败,用户可以联系TP钱包的技术支持团队,寻求进一步的帮助和解决方案。
拓展-TP钱包的其他功能
除了合约交互,TP钱包还提供了其他功能,例如:
- 数字货币存储:用户可以安全地存储以太币、ERC-20代币等数字货币。
- 发送和接收:用户可以通过TP钱包发送和接收以太币及其他支持的数字货币。
- 浏览器功能:TP钱包内置了以太坊区块链浏览器,用户可以查看交易记录、地址信息等。
- 代币交易所:TP钱包还提供了内置的代币交易所,用户可以进行代币交易。
总结来说,TP钱包合约交互失败时不会自动退回交易。因此,用户在使用TP钱包进行合约交互时应当仔细确认合约地址和参数,以避免不必要的损失。